Ubuntu Security Notice USN-1858-1
June 05, 2013
libxfixes vulnerability
==========================================================================
A security issue affects these releases of Ubuntu and its derivatives:
- Ubuntu 13.04
- Ubuntu 12.10
- Ubuntu 12.04 LTS
Summary:
Several security issues were fixed in libxfixes.
Software Description:
- libxfixes: X11 miscellaneous fixes extension library
Details:
Ilja van Sprundel discovered multiple security issues in various X.org
libraries and components. An attacker could use these issues to cause
applications to crash, resulting in a denial of service, or possibly
execute arbitrary code.
Update instructions:
The problem can be corrected by updating your system to the following
package versions:
Ubuntu 13.04:
libxfixes3 1:5.0-4ubuntu5.13.04.1
Ubuntu 12.10:
libxfixes3 1:5.0-4ubuntu5.12.10.1
Ubuntu 12.04 LTS:
libxfixes3 1:5.0-4ubuntu4.1
After a standard system update you need to restart your session to make all
the necessary changes.
